Analysis

Israel recorded 7.9% for barro-lee: percentage of female population age 35-39 with primary in 2010. That is the lowest value across all 11 years on record.

The figure is down 45.2% over ten years.

Over the whole period, barro-lee: percentage of female population age 35-39 with primary in Israel peaked at 42.4% in 1960 and was at its lowest, 7.9%, in 2010.

That places Israel 92nd out of 144 countries with data for 2010,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 11 years of available data.

Barro-Lee: Percentage of female population age 35-39 with primary in Israel, year by year

Annual values for Barro-Lee: Percentage of female population age 35-39 with primary schooling. Total (Incomplete and Completed Primary) in Israel, 1960 to 2010.
Year Incomplete and Completed Primary Change
1960 42.4%
1965 39.1% -7.8%
1970 36.5% -6.6%
1975 28.8% -21.0%
1980 27.6% -4.3%
1985 21.3% -22.7%
1990 20.3% -5.0%
1995 18.0% -11.1%
2000 14.4% -20.3%
2005 15.4% +7.0%
2010 7.9% -48.7%
